As you may already know, Italian property can be a bureaucratic nightmare. The process of buying property in Abruzzo can be especially arduous.

Buying our first house in Italy meant navigating a minefield of problems. After 7 months of searching, we finally found our perfect Italian location. Feeling pleased with ourselves, we then went on to discover that the property was owned by a dead granny, her two sons, their five children and three cousins.

Every one of them, excluding Granny of course, had to be involved in the house selling process. Each one had to be present at the “compromesso” (exchange of contracts) and again at the “L'atto”, (completion).

Property in Abruzzo is often sub-divided and ours was no exception! We had to have a contract with each individual owner, incurring serious extra costs we weren't originally warned of.

This frustrating process also demanded a huge amount of time and 6 months spent travelling to and from Abruzzo meant further expenses for flights, car rental and hotels.

Property in Abruzzo: FactFile
  • Property in Abruzzo

    is estimated to have risen in value by 7.3% in the past year and 40-50% over the past decade.
  • Property is 30-70% cheaper in Abruzzo than in Tuscany / Umbria.
  • A two bedroom apartment in Pineto, on the Adriatic Coast, typically costs £80,000 (€118,000).
  • Ryanair flies to Pescara & Ancona. EasyJet flies to Rome.
